1. Specifications Comparison
Feature | Honor Magic5 Lite | Xiaomi Redmi 13C 5G | Practical Impact |
---|---|---|---|
Design | |||
Dimensions (mm) | 161.6 x 73.9 x 7.9 | 168 x 78 x 8.1 | Redmi 13C is larger and slightly thicker. Magic5 Lite is more pocketable. |
Weight (g) | 175 | 192 | Magic5 Lite is noticeably lighter, reducing hand fatigue during extended use. |
Display | |||
Display Type | AMOLED | IPS LCD | Magic5 Lite offers richer colors, deeper blacks, and better power efficiency due to AMOLED technology. Redmi 13C's LCD may be brighter in direct sunlight. |
Display Size (inches) | 6.67 | 6.74 | Negligible size difference. |
Resolution | 1080 x 2400 | 720 x 1600 | Significantly sharper and more detailed visuals on the Magic5 Lite. Text and images will be clearer. |
Refresh Rate (Hz) | 120 | 90 | Smoother animations and scrolling on the Magic5 Lite, especially noticeable in games and fast-paced UI interactions. |
PPI | 395 | 260 | Magic5 Lite has a much higher pixel density, resulting in sharper text and images. |
Performance | |||
Chipset | Snapdragon 695 5G | Dimensity 6100+ | Both offer comparable mid-range performance, but specific benchmarks are needed for accurate comparison. |
CPU | Octa-core (2x2.2 GHz Kryo 660 Gold & 6x1.7 GHz Kryo 660 Silver) | Octa-core (2x2.2 GHz Cortex-A76 & 6x2.0 GHz Cortex-A55) | Similar CPU configurations, although architectural differences may lead to slight performance variations. |
GPU | Adreno 619 | Mali-G57 MC2 | Gaming performance may vary. More information is needed to make a definitive comparison. |
RAM (GB) | 6/8 | 4/6/8 | Depending on the version, the Magic5 Lite may offer more RAM, enabling better multitasking. |
Camera | |||
Main Camera (MP) | 64 | 50 | Magic5 Lite has a higher resolution main sensor, potentially capturing more detail. Practical image quality depends on sensor size and processing. |
Selfie Camera (MP) | 16 | 5 | Higher resolution selfie camera on the Magic5 Lite. |
Video Recording | 1080p@30fps | 1080p@30fps | Both offer similar video recording capabilities. |
Battery | |||
Capacity (mAh) | 5100 | 5000 | Negligible difference in battery capacity. Real-world battery life depends on usage patterns and software optimization. |
Fast Charging | 40W | 18W | Significantly faster charging on the Magic5 Lite. |
Other | |||
NFC | Yes | No | Magic5 Lite supports contactless payments and data transfer via NFC. |
OS | Android 12 | Android 13 | Redmi 13C comes with a newer Android version out of the box. Magic5 Lite can be upgraded to Android 13. |
Price Range | Medium | Medium | Prices overlap, making value a key consideration.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Honor Magic5 Lite Advantages:
- Superior Display: AMOLED with higher resolution, refresh rate, and pixel density.
- Faster Charging: 40W vs 18W.
- NFC: Enables contactless payments.
- Lighter and More Compact: Easier to handle and carry.
Xiaomi Redmi 13C 5G Advantages:
- Lower Price: Generally more affordable, especially the base variant.
- Newer Android Version: Ships with Android 13.
- Slightly Larger Battery: Though the difference is minimal.
3. User Profiles & Recommendations
Honor Magic5 Lite: Users who prioritize display quality, faster charging, and a premium feel. Ideal for media consumption, gaming, and mobile photography enthusiasts.
Xiaomi Redmi 13C 5G: Budget-conscious users who need a large screen and basic functionality. Suitable for casual users primarily focused on communication and web browsing.
4. Decision Framework
Key Questions for Buyers:
- What is your budget? The Redmi 13C is generally cheaper.
- How important is display quality? The Magic5 Lite's AMOLED display is significantly better.
- Do you need NFC for contactless payments? This is only available on the Magic5 Lite.
My Choice: Honor Magic5 Lite
While the Redmi 13C 5G offers a lower price, the Honor Magic5 Lite provides a significantly better user experience due to its superior display, faster charging, NFC functionality, and more compact design. The slightly higher price is justified by these tangible benefits. The sharper screen, smoother scrolling, and quicker charging contribute to a more enjoyable daily usage. While the Redmi 13C is a decent budget option, the Magic5 Lite offers better value in the mid-range segment.
